Things to do in Douglas?
Douglas, MA is a small town located in Worcester County. The town has a population of around 8,300 people and it is known for its rural charm and beautiful landscapes. Residents here enjoy the simple pleasures of living in a small community with plenty of outdoor recreational activities such as fishing, hiking, biking and camping. The town has some local eateries and shops which give it a unique character and quaint appeal. Overall, Douglas provides a peaceful environment to live with close proximity to larger cities like Worcester and Boston for more excursions.

Things to do in Arcata?
Nestled on California’s North Coast just south of Eureka, Arcata offers visitors an array of natural beauty from redwood forests to rugged coastline along with world-class dining experiences like the Alice Copper Restaurant & Brewery. The city hosts a variety of cultural attractions year round from art galleries to live music venues making it a great destination for everyone.
